Post by Felix the Cat »

My main criticism would be that the screenies are all too "busy". There's way too much going on in each of them for them to be pretty. The majority of them lack a focus or a subject of the screenie; they're just lots of stuff shooting lots of stuff with lots of explosions, which is not art.

Take a look at some of BA's loadscreens, and note how most of them have one subject for the image. (However, one lesson that you should not draw from them is that cheap photoshop filters make pictures better.)

You might also want to google some sites on the basics of photography, because you're essentially taking photographs in a digital environment. You're looking for a treatment of basics like the role of the foreground, background, subjects, etc. (not photograph-only things like focus and lighting, because you have no control over those in Spring).
